And there is one other reason. I have decided to do a Big Year. Ok, not like the movie Big Year, at least not exactly. I just want to document all of the birds I see in a year. Try to see new ones, but not go to crazy on it. Many people sink tons of time and money into Big Years. I just want to dedicate more time to birding. In Indiana in particular, and in State Parks as much as I can. I was inspired by the Indiana Bicentennial Celebration, which is this year. The Indiana Audubon Society is trying to encourage people and so I'm going to take the bait. I have to document all the birds I see (more about this later) and try to see as many as I can in 1 year (2016 to be exact).
